Donna Faust Obituary

Donna G. Faust, 80, of Linden passed away Monday, March 18, 2024 at the Gatehouse.

Born January 16, 1944, in Williamsport she was the only child of Ray W. and Muriel Guthrie.

A 1961 graduate of Williamsport High School, Donna's passion for learning led her to Lock Haven University, where she earned a degree in early education.  Her commitment to shaping young minds was evident throughout her 37-year career as an elementary school teacher; beginning at J. George Becht Elementary School and retiring from Four Mile Elementary School in 1999. Her kindness and friendly nature left an indelible mark on the countless students she guided.

An enthusiastic supporter of local arts and sports, Donna and Bink enjoyed live performances as annual members of the Williamsport Symphony Orchestra and the Community Arts Center. They were season ticket holders for the Williamsport Crosscutters; enjoying the thrill of the game, the camaraderie of fellow fans, and hosting numerous players in their home through the seasons.

Donna's week was often highlighted by her weekly coffee group gatherings, where she shared laughter and conversation with close friends. She was an avid collector of Longaberger baskets, hosting countless parties in her home. Scrapbooking was another of Donna's cherished hobbies, she was particularly fond of sending Christmas cards that narrated the year's adventures that she and Bink shared. They loved traveling; taking many trips to Germany, Alaska and the shore.

Her life was a testament to the joy of simply being with family and friends, which was her greatest passion.

Surviving is her loving husband of 56 years, William S. “Bink” Faust; siblings-in-law, Cheri Dieffenbacher (Gordon), Ned Faust (Chris), and David Bennett; nieces and nephews who she loved like children, Rebekah, Hannah, Micah, Chad, Crystal, Spencer and Lindsay; and her great nieces and nephews, Charlie, Gabriel, Max, Anneliese, and Corbin.

In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by a sister-in-law, Connie Bennett.

As per her wishes, no services will be held.
